Logo PIN code lock
This function prevents an unauthorized person from
changing the screen logo.
Off ............ The screen logo can be changed freely from
the Logo Menu (p.48).
On ............ The screen logo cannot be changed without
a Logo PIN code.
If you want to change the Logo PIN code lock setting,
press the SELECT button and the Logo PIN code dialog
box appears. Enter a Logo PIN code by following the
steps below. The initial Logo PIN code is set to "4321" at
the factory.

Change the Logo PIN code
Logo PIN code can be changed to your desired four-digit
number. Press the Point
code change" and then press the SELECT button. The
New Logo PIN code input dialog box appears. Set a new
Logo PIN code.
Be sure to note the new Logo PIN code and keep it at
hand. If you lost the number, you could no longer change
the Logo PIN code setting. For details on PIN code
setting, refer to "PIN code lock" on pages 53–54.
